Job description

Akumin is a leading provider of outpatient radiology and oncology services, partnering with top hospitals and health systems nationwide to deliver advanced diagnostic imaging and exceptional patient care close to home. With a national footprint, cutting-edge technology, and a strong commitment to innovation and patient-centered care, our teams play a vital role in improving outcomes for millions of patients each year.

We are currently hiring for an Employee Relations Specialist to join our team. This will be a full-time, remote role, located within the United States.

The Employee Relations Specialist serves as the first point of contact for employees and managers regarding workplace concerns, policy interpretation, and employee relations matters. This role is responsible for conducting intake, assessing and triaging employee relations issues, supporting investigations, conflict resolution, policy interpretation and independently managing routine employee relations cases. The Employee Relations Specialist partners closely with the Senior Manager, Employee Relations to promote a positive employee experience while ensuring compliance with company policies and applicable employment laws.

Specific duties include, but are not limited to:
  • Serve as the first point of contact for employees and managers reporting workplace concerns or policy questions. Document initial statements, gather preliminary facts, and present findings to the Sr. Manager, ER. Escalate high-risk or complex cases (e.g., harassment, discrimination) to senior leadership immediately.
  • Independently manage and investigate routine employee relations cases, including attendance issues, dress code violations, conduct concerns, and basic performance conflicts, while consulting with the Senior Manager, Employee Relations on more complex matters. Partner with managers to develop and deliver performance improvement plans (PIPs) and corrective actions.
  • Maintain accurate, confidential, and up-to-date records of all ER inquiries and investigations in the case management system. Ensure all practices comply with internal policies and applicable federal, state, and local employment laws.
  • Advise employees and frontline managers on company policies, procedures, and basic HR best practices.
  • Assist with the development, communication, and delivery of HR policies, employee relations training, and compliance initiatives. Support employee and manager education on workplace expectations and company policies.
Position Requirements:
  • Bachelor's Degree or Equivalent Experience
  • 1–3 years of experience in Human Resources, with a demonstrated focus or strong interest in Employee Relations.
  • Excellent active listening, verbal, and written communication skills. Strong objective, analytical, and conflict-resolution abilities.
  • Basic understanding of employment laws (e.g., FMLA, ADA, FLSA) and standard HR compliance protocols
